Blackford’s big week is packed with action

- JOHNATHON MENZIES

Final preparatio­ns are being made ahead of this year’s Blackford Gala Week.

This year’s jam-packed programme of events is due to run in the village from June 4-11 as part of a tradition which dates back to the late 1970s.

Blackford Parish Church will be the venue for a special all-age service from 11.30am on Sunday, June 4.

After refreshmen­ts, a community bike ride will leave the church from 2pm and see participan­ts head out through the gwest grounds using the core path and the Gleneagles cycle path.

Basketball is to take place the following day on the all-weather court behind Allanwater Gardens, starting from 6.30pm for children and families and then from 7.30pm for teenagers or those slightly older wishing to shoot some hoops.

More exercise can be enjoyed on Tuesday, June 6, as a family games night – including rounders and football – takes place in the Highland Games field from 6.30pm.

A walking treasure hunt will see participan­ts gather at Blackford Bowling Club from 6.30pm on Wednesday, June 7, and compete for the newly-created Willie Mclaren Trophy.

Explaining the poignant nod to the event’s history, a Blackford Gala Week spokespers­on said: “Willie Mclaren, of Netherton Farm, was instrument­al in establishi­ng Blackford Gala.

“Willie sadly died in May, 2022, and we are delighted that his wife, Cathie, and other members of the family have supported the idea of a Willie Mclaren Trophy to mark his contributi­on to the Gala and to the village.

“This trophy will be awarded annually to the winner of the adult walking treasure hunt.

“Fittingly it is Willie’s son, William, as winner of last year’s event, who will set this year’s courses.
